Are soft pods the same as K-cups?

A Pod is coffee or tea that is sealed inside filter paper. They have a round, flat shape and are usually soft and pliable. Pods are also known as coffee pads. A K-Cup is is coffee or tea (and recently hot chocolate and cappuccino) that is sealed in some kind of cartridge, generally a plastic cup.

Do all Keurigs use the same K-cups?

No K-cups and Coffee Pods are NOT the same and are NOT interchangeable. K-cups are specifically designed to be used in the Keurig single cup coffee maker only. Keurig has recently changed the name of their “K-CUP” to “K-CUP PODS” but they are very different than actual paper coffee pods.

What’s the difference between soft and firm coffee pods?

Soft pods are lighter in weight (about 7 grams) and are obviously soft, meaning that they are not firm like most pods. This gives more flexibility when using in brewers with tight clearance like the Senseo® and Hamilton Beach® brewers and will result in a better extraction in these brewers.
